eSIM vs. Physical SIM: A Speed & Bandwidth Analysis
Considering data transfer rates , the distinction between digital SIMs and physical SIMs is usually negligible. Both kinds of SIM modules utilize the network provider's infrastructure and present network capacity . As a result, real-world performance will be mostly determined by factors like tower proximity, the user’s subscription and your phone’s modem potential . This is unlikely for an digital SIM to inherently provide superior bandwidth than a plastic SIM – the experience will be very similar in most cases.

eSIM Data Speed Test: Factors Affecting Your Results
Conducting an eSIM data speed test can be frustrating if you're seeing the anticipated performance. Several variables can impact your connection velocity. Here's a breakdown at some key factors at play :
- Network Traffic: Like any wireless connection, eSIM speeds are affected by how many users are sharing the a base station .
- eSIM Subscription Limits: Your data plan might have data limits imposed by your copyright .
- Signal Power: A poor signal will consistently lead to slower speeds. Think about your signal bars.
- eSIM Functionality with Your Device: Certain phones may inadequately support the highest speeds of your eSIM.
- Network Protocol : The generation of network technology (e.g., 5G, 4G LTE) plays a critical role.
- Location of the Speed Test Service: The distance between you and the testing location can influence your speed .
Recognizing these influences will help you interpret your eSIM internet speed checks more precisely.
